Why No Fraud Is a Bad Sign with Tedd Huff

Published: May 22, 2018, 9 a.m.

Fact: If you have no fraud, you’re losing business.

On today’s Payments Innovation podcast, Chris (Currencycloud) talks to Tedd Huff (VP of Product, GlobalOnePay) about who has the most online fraud, what makes fraud “friendly,” and where the future of fraud prevention is headed.

“Online fraud on average ranges anywhere from 0.3% up to 3% of total revenues for businesses in North America,” Tedd said.

It usually isn’t possible to stop a breach once it’s happened. So stopping it ahead of time is the key piece to handling fraud.